## Dialpad numbers

Every Dialpad Connect user is assigned a direct Dialpad number under **Your Dialpad Numbers**. If your Admin has added a [fax line](/v1/docs/send-receive-a-fax) or a [Dialpad Meetings account,](/v1/docs/using-dialpad-meetings-via-the-dialpad-app) you'll see those numbers, too.

> [!NOTE]
> Why do I have two numbers?
> 
> When you sign up for a Dialpad account, [we automatically give you a free local Main Line number](/v1/docs/manage-a-main-line) which cannot be removed. This number is considered your Company's phone number that your callers can call to reach out to any operator assigned to your mainline.
> 
> The second number you receive is your direct Dialpad number, which callers would use to reach out to you directly.
> 
> Don't like the numbers you were assigned? No problem!—in fact, you'll have the option after you finish the sign-up flow to [port in an existing local or toll-free number.](/v1/docs/porting-faqs)

## Caller ID

In the **Caller ID** section, you'll see which number will appear when you place an outbound call. It is set to your direct number by default, but you may see other options if you're assigned as an operator or agent, or if your admin chose to [enable office-wide caller ID settings](/v1/docs/enable-office-wide-caller-id).

![User interface showing a user's Your Settings page. Options for Caller ID are displayed and highlighted.](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/Caller_ID.png)

## Language

The **Language** section lets you change the language of your Dialpad App experience.

Office settings set a user's default language, but it can also be changed for their individual Dialpad account.

To change the language, simply select a different option from the drop-down menu. Dialpad will update automatically.

## Timezone

Your Dialpad timezone is set to Pacific Standard Time (PST) by default, so don't forget to change it if you’re located in a different region.

To change the timezone, simply select a different option from the drop-down menu. Dialpad will update automatically.

If you haven’t set your Personal Working Hours, and it's between 7 PM and 8 AM, when a teammate writes you a Dialpad message, they’ll see a notification letting them know what time it is for you.

## User & voicemail PIN

Dialpad provides an auto-generated PIN that users can change. This PIN is required for actions like checking voicemails, recording a voicemail greeting, and toggling Do Not Disturb mode.

To change your PIN, select **change**,****then enter your new PIN and select **Save.** ![User interface showing a user's Your Settings page. The User &amp; Voicemail PIN is highlighted.](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/User_Voicemail_PIN.png)

## Voicemail drop

When enabled, [Voicemail Drop](/v1/docs/voicemail-drop) plays a pre-recorded message to leave a voicemail on an outbound call.

> [!NOTE]
> Who can use Voicemail Drop
> 
> Voicemail drop is provided for Dialpad Sell users on an Advanced or Premium plan.
> 
> It's also offered as a paid add-on for Contact Center users, and Essential Dialpad Sell users.

To turn on Voicemail Drop, **check the box** beside **Enable Voicemail Drop.** ![](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/your-profile-voicemail-drop.png) Dialpad lets you choose between the default greeting or a custom greeting set by you. If you choose a custom greeting, you can upload an MP3 file or record audio from within Dialpad.

## Dialpad AI

Dialpad AI can transcribe your calls and meetings in real time, track keywords that come up in conversations, detect customer sentiment, and more!

To turn on AI, navigate to Dialpad AI, then **check the box** beside **Automatically start AI for calls and meetings**.

### **Ring duration**

Set a Ring duration to determine how long your devices will ring.

To set the ring duration, adjust the slider to choose the desired length (in seconds) for how long the call should ring.

![ring_duration.png](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/ring_duration.png)

### **Call handling**

The Call Handling section lets you determine how a call is handled when you’re on another call.

You can choose the following options:

- **Call Waiting:** The caller will wait until you’re free and you’ll receive an on-screen alert.
- **Play Busy Signal:**The callers will wait until you’re free.****You won't receive an alert and the caller will hear a busy signal.
- **Go to Advanced Routing Options:** The caller will be sent directly to voicemail, a message, another team member or room phone, a Department, or an automated response menu.

### Press 0 to skip voicemail option

Give callers the option to press 0 during your voicemail greeting and route them to another number, like your mainline or another shared line.

To turn on the skip voicemail option, select **Call handling and voicemail**.

1. Navigate to **Forward Voicemail Option 0 to the Following Destination**
2. Check the box beside **Forward Voicemail Option 0 to the following Destination**
  1. Forward to main line
  2. Choose another destination

> [!NOTE]
> Note
> 
> You can only select groups that you have visibility into or access to. To use a shared line as an option, you must be assigned as an operator on that shared line.

## Your devices

In the **Your devices** section, you'll see a list of [connected devices](/v1/docs/manage-your-dialpad-devices) and additional information such as forwarding number (if applicable), the date it was last connected, and if the device is set to ring. ![Your Devices, showing options to add a new device, see advanced settings, or force a logout.](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/Your_Devices.png)

- Select **Add New**to [add a desk phone](https://help.dialpad.com/docs/manage-a-user-desk-phone) or [forwarding number](https://help.dialpad.com/v1/docs/manage-your-dialpad-devices#add-a-forwarding-number).
- Select **Force logout** to remotely log out of your devices.
- Select **Advanced Settings** to choose the caller ID you want to see when receiving an inbound call to a forwarding number, e.g. Dialpad calls forwarded to your mobile phone.

## Executive Assistant

The Executive Assistant section displays your [Executive Assistant (EA) pairings](/v1/docs/assign-executive-assistant-pairings).

Admins typically create EA pairings, but users can also request to be paired as either an Executive or an Assistant.

To request a pairing, select **+ Add a new Assistant** and follow the prompts.

![Executive Assistant section showing options to add a user as an executive or as an assistant.](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/Executive_Assistant.png)

In either case, both parties will have to confirm from an emailed notification before the changes take place.

## Working location

Use a [personal working location](https://help.dialpad.com/v1/docs/en/e911-emergency-services#add-a-personal-working-location) to override your office's default E911 address so that First Responders can find you if you dial 911 and you’re not at the office. To add a working location, select **Add location** and follow the prompts. ![Your Profile page showing the working Location option.](https://cdn.us.document360.io/0f28ad44-2863-4372-a27e-c6728808d742/Images/Documentation/Working_Location.png)

Dialpad lets you save up to 10 locations, so you don’t need to add a new address every time you visit a different office.
